boxtel Posted February 20, 2006 Share Posted February 20, 2006 Thank you for your answer Kristofor! I need help with seo rewrite link for romanian laguage (in english work fine). The words from title (products, caregories) is not separate with "-". EX: English: ...../notebook-inspiron-p-165.html?manufacturers_id=25&osCsid=741b3e9ac85ff0da1fdb93ddd04b1ee5 Romanian: ...../notebookdellinspiron6000pm730-p-165.html?manufacturers_id=25&osCsid=741b3e9ac85ff0da1fdb93ddd04b1ee5 Regards! well, in the seo modules the spaces in the names etc. are replaced by - so it looks like the modules do not recognize your romanian space characters. baluvee Posted March 1, 2006 Share Posted March 1, 2006 I tried to install this mod on a windows server, unfortunatily it did not work. HTTP Server: Microsoft-IIS/6.0 PHP Versie: 4.3.10 (Zend: 1.3.0) First of all, does this contrib work on windows server or not? Not localy, and I can not change much on the server, I just rent the space. If I know that, I'll try to find out how to get it working? I look in this topic but could not get an straight answere... It works on windows and apache but not on IIS Hilton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
tolster Posted March 1, 2006 Share Posted March 1, 2006 Thank you for the clear answere.... BUT WHY NOT :'( Any other SEO URL that someone can recomment to me?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Ricky Posted March 1, 2006 Share Posted March 1, 2006 because the url_rewrite is a feature of apache so it only works with apache web server Quote .......... ........... Free Image Hosting : ImageTor.com ........... ........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
